The Importance of Pool Maintenance in Highlands Ranch

Colorado's high altitude creates distinct pool care challenges. The intense UV exposure combined with low humidity means that pool chemical balance requires careful attention. Our professional pool service knows exactly how to address these factors.

Essential Regular Pool Maintenance Tasks

Consistent weekly maintenance forms the key to equipment longevity. Homeowners serving the local area should understand these critical tasks:

  • Pool cleaning – Clearing the surface prevents filter damage
  • Circulation system care – A blocked filter reduces equipment performance
  • Pool chemical balance – Consistent monitoring maintains safe swimming conditions
  • System checks – Regular inspections catch maintenance needs before they become costly

Year-Round Pool Care Plans

Seasonal pool maintenance vary significantly in Colorado. Residents near local shopping districts experience dramatic seasonal changes that demand flexible scheduling.

Spring Opening: As temperatures warm in the Highlands Ranch area, pool startup requires thorough cleaning. Our professional team will test systems for active use.

Summer Maintenance: Peak usage season demands intensive pool care. Weekly pool maintenance becomes essential as recreational activity peaks.

Fall Preparation: Before winter arrives, seasonal pool care protects your equipment. Leaf removal prevents maintenance issues.

Winter Storage: For homeowners considering off-season storage, proper winterization procedures are essential. Our experts ensure your filtration systems survive Colorado's harsh winters.
